David, thanks for your exhaustive reply. After I wrote my post yesterday I looked it little bit further into the structure of the .xml file you sent me and decided to create a new .xml for all three lenses using the RF16 2.8 data in the Lensfun file: mil-Canon.xml. The resulting file is attached below and it works like a charm! Maybe other Canon users can use that file also. Oddly enough the metadata of my RF35-F1.8 is recognized properly by Affinity so not all Canon RF lenses are a problem for Affinity.
I just deleted the Adobe DNG converter from my PC since it did not work properly but I will try your tip for the 70-300 mm lens also.
Hopefully all this will help to get some more bugs in the Affinity photo program corrected by the makers.
CanonR7-280-286-288.xml